I love how funky this is, and I didn’t like the multi-ear stuff at first but when the lead synth kicked in it clicked. Great work on this one!

Viraxor responds:

The hard-panning is an Amiga "limitation". There are only 4 available channels on the Amiga, two panned left and two panned right. Thanks for the review!
